Library Services Assistant
Grade 2 £20,812 - £22,777 Pro Rata
Part time
An opportunity has arisen for a fixed term contract of 12 months at 21.9 hours per week in the Reader Services Team of the Library of Birmingham
Reader Services offer a range of facilities and materials that support formal and informal learning as well as reading for leisure and pleasure. The service encompasses adult fiction and non-fiction on the busy lending terraces, subject information collections and study spaces and levels 2 and 3 of the Library of Birmingham.
The team also has a city-wide role and manages electronic resources such as e-audio books, downloaded e-books, e-magazines, online newspapers and e-comics/graphic novels, Reading Group Sets and loans to hostels, shelter and places of refuge.
We are looking for an enthusiastic colleague with excellent customer skills to join them in a busy frontline service, supporting the manager and team in delivering a wide range of library services to the public including: delivery of the enquiry service and supporting customers to access other floors and services within the Library of Birmingham. You will be involved in the day to day running of the service and have duties which will include working with collections, stock management and maintenance; assisting with colleagues with other promotional activities and events for families and other groups; and in producing printed resources & displays.
The role’s working patterns including Saturdays and some evening work up until 19:15.
